User experience determines the success of secure access service edge (SASE) programs, yet DNS and DHCP often go unnoticed until failures occur. These issues can appear as application outages, software-as-a-service (SaaS) slowdowns or site-specific problems that require extensive troubleshooting. 

Infoblox Universal DDI™ Management is Infoblox's approach to delivering resilient and flexible DNS and DHCP services across any environment, spanning SaaS-based NIOS-X as a Service and NIOS-X physical and virtual servers.

Now, with the DDI Integration for SASE, Infoblox is partnering with leading SASE and software-defined wide area network (SD-WAN) providers to help customers modernize DDI for distributed branch networks. This approach simplifies deployment, increases resiliency with cost savings and ensures consistency across sites.
